On our fun morning of pig keeping, you will learn about:

  • The legislation required that governs both the keeping and movement of pigs – and the requirements of the pig keeper to keep within this legislation
  • Selecting the right area within the smallholding to keep your pigs
  • Options for pig housing, and for bedding
  • Different types of fencing for keeping your pig contained
  • Selecting the right breed of pig for your needs, including where to source the right weaner
  • Handling your pig safely and completing basic health checks
  • What to feed your pigs from weaners through to slaughter, to ensure the correct fat coverage
  • Preparing your pigs for slaughter, choosing an abattoir and butcher
  • Selecting the right cuts for your needs
